1. TensorFlow in Practice Specialization

What’s it about?

  • Instructors: Laurence Moroney, Andrew Ng, and more.
  • Duration: About 4 months (go at your own pace).
  • For who? Newbies and those in the intermediate zone.

What You’ll Learn:

  • The basics of TensorFlow.
  • Building and training deep neural networks.
  • Dabbling in computer vision with Convolutional Neural Networks (CNNs).
  • Taking on natural language processing projects.

Why You Should Dive In: This one is like a TensorFlow rollercoaster — it starts with the basics and takes you on a ride through real-world applications. Perfect for both starters and those looking to dive a bit deeper.

2. TensorFlow: Data and Deployment Specialization

What’s it about?

  • Instructors: Andrew Ng and a bunch of industry experts.
  • Duration: Roughly 4 months (no need to rush).
  • For who? Intermediate-level enthusiasts.

What You’ll Learn:

  • Cleaning and preparing data for machine learning.
  • Deploying models to the real world.
  • Building scalable and efficient data pipelines.
  • Fixing and optimizing deployed models.

Why You Should Check It Out: This one is like the bridge between training models and making them work in the real world. If you want to take your TensorFlow skills out of the notebook and into the real deal, this is your go-to.

3. Machine Learning with TensorFlow on Google Cloud Platform Specialization

What’s it about?

  • Instructors: The Google Cloud Training Team.
  • Duration: About 4 months (take your time with it).
  • For who? Intermediate-level learners.

What You’ll Learn:

  • Blending TensorFlow into Google Cloud Platform (GCP) workflows.
  • Putting machine learning solutions into action on GCP.
  • Delving into the cool stuff like hyperparameter tuning and neural architecture search.

Why You Should Dive In: If you’re eyeing the power of Google Cloud for your machine learning ventures, this is tailor-made for you. Get hands-on with integrating TensorFlow with GCP services.

4. Intro to Machine Learning with TensorFlow

What’s it about?

  • Instructors: Laurence Moroney.
  • Duration: Around 6 hours (quick and snappy).
  • For who? Complete beginners.

What You’ll Learn:

  • Grasping the basics of machine learning.
  • Building and training a basic model using TensorFlow.
  • Getting the hang of image classification and natural language processing.

Why You Should Check It Out: For those taking their first steps into machine learning, this is like a friendly handshake. It’s short, sweet, and gives you a solid base to jump into further exploration.

5. Advanced Machine Learning with TensorFlow on Google Cloud Platform Specialization

What’s it about?

  • Instructors: The Google Cloud Training Team.
  • Duration: Around 4 months (take it at your own pace).
  • For who? Advanced learners.

What You’ll Learn:

  • Mastering advanced TensorFlow concepts.
  • Cooking up machine learning models ready for action on GCP.
  • Exploring fancy topics like reinforcement learning and recommendation systems.

Why You Should Dive In: For the TensorFlow veterans, this is like the masterclass. If you’re ready to tackle complex challenges and deploy some seriously advanced models, this course is your ticket.
